Many alphaIIbbeta3 autoepitopes in chronic immune thrombocytopenic purpura are localized to alphaIIb between amino acids L1 and Q459.

In chronic immune thrombocytopenic purpura (ITP), autoantibodies bind to platelet surface proteins, particularly αIIb, resulting in platelet destruction by the reticulo‐endothelial system. In order to better localize the autoepitopes on αIIb, we studied the binding of antibodies to Chinese hamster ovary (CHO) cells expressing either αIIbβ3or αIIb‐αvβ3chimaeras in which a segment of αIIb(either amino acids L1‐Q459, L1‐F223 or F223‐Q459) was substituted for that portion of αv. We evaluated platelet‐associated autoantibodies from 14 ITP patients with αIIb‐dependent antibodies. Ten of 14 bound to αIIb (L1‐Q459)‐αvβ3, showing that autoepitopes were often localized to this region of αIIb. In addition, each of the autoantibodies binding to αIIb (L1‐Q459)‐αvβ3, also bound to CHO cells expressing either αIIb(L1‐F223)‐αvβ3or αIIb(F223‐Q459)‐αvβ3). In two of the three eluates tested, > 95% of the autoantibody binding to αIIbcould be adsorbed using CHO cells expressing any of the three chimaeras, showing that the epitope(s) have contact points on either side of amino acid F223; in the third eluate, only a portion (∼40%) could be adsorbed by the chimaeric cell lines showing that, in this patient, an additional antibody was also present, directed to a site distal to amino acid Q459. The remaining four eluates bound to CHO cells expressing αIIbβ3but to none of the chimaeras, suggesting that these epitopes are also distal to amino acid Q459. We conclude that the binding of many anti‐αIIbβ3autoantibodies is dependent on the presence of αIIbamino acids L1‐Q459.
